Ways to Give

  • Estate Beneficiary: Designate Ƶ as a beneficiary in your will, either as a percentage of your estate or a specific amount.
  • Retirement Plan Beneficiary: Designate Ƶ as a beneficiary of your retirement account(s).
  • Residual Bequest: Designate a specific amount or percentage of your estate to Ƶ after your assets have been distributed to other priorities.
